The R&S FSL is an extremely lightweight and compact spectrum analyzer for cost-conscious users who want the functionality of high-end instruments. The analyzer is ideal for a large number of applications in development, service and production.
Despite its compact size, it offers a wealth of functions more typical of the high-end range, thus ensuring an excellent price/performance ratio. The R&S®FSL is the only instrument in its class that features a tracking generator up to 18 GHz and can analyze signals with a bandwidth of 28 MHz. In addition, the R&S®FSL18, which operates at frequencies up to 18 GHz, supports applications in the microwave range.
* Frequency range 9 kHz to 3 GHz, 6 GHz or 18 GHz
* Models with and without tracking generator
* Signal analysis bandwidth of 28 MHz
* Low measurement uncertainty, even in microwave range
* General measurement applications, e.g. spectrogram
* Lightweight and compact for on-site installation, maintenance and service
* Optional battery operation
* Easy on-site upgrading with options
